Support for Many Digital Modes
Operate the most popular modes in one app — with more on the way.
📶 Core Modes
iDigi supports a broad set of modes used worldwide:
PSK, RTTY
CW
SSTV (more than 100 SSTV modes)
FT4 and FT8
WSPR
WEFAX
🧭 Roadmap
Actively developed with additional modes planned:
Hellschreiber (Feld-Hell)
MFSK
Olivia

Highly Integrated
Real-time spot display with GridTracker2
Automatic QSO log transfer to MacLoggerDX, RUMLogNG, GridTracker2, or any N1MM-compatible logger running locally or on your LAN
Automatic QSO uploads to LoTW, QRZ.com, eQSL, Clublog, and Wavelog
Callsign and station lookups via QRZ.com and HamQTH
Rig control via Hamlib, supporting virtually any CAT-capable transceiver over serial or network connections (list of supported radios)
DXLab Commander CAT Control Support

Audio Recording & Playback
⏺️ Audio Recording and Playbak
Record received and transmitted audio as AIFF or MP4
Replay recordings for decoding within iDigi
Adjustable playback speed (up to ×128) — ideal for slower modes like WEFAX
Built-In Logbook
🗂️ Powerful & Beautiful
Modern log with a world map view
Statistics for your QSOs
🔁 Import / Export
ADIF import & export
Cabrillo export
☁️ One-Click Uploads
Upload to eQSL.cc, QRZ.com, Club Log, LoTW
Direct LoTW support — no TQSL required
Manual or automatic instant upload
🔗 N1MM Integration
Real-time log sharing via the N1MM protocol to compatible loggers on your local network.
